I would like the possibility of having the number of always shown Buttons configurable and cooldown / duration spirals (as an option instead of bars).
Being in the same boat maintaining Poppins I would be most happy if someone would actually make popupbars with the new secure templates work at all to get an idea - I will not be the first one, this is way beyond me.
My personal dream although would be Yapa - Yet another Popbutton addon with generic Buttons in a core and a module system for Totems etc. - actually the way Poppins was designed by Sorata I admit but with more manpower behind the code than my little self. The optimum would be a shared codebase / Core with Toadkillers Autobar - an "auto" periodic module, a totem module...Just a wild idea I know but why not bring it on the table ;)
- Registered User
Member for 11 years, 7 months, and 2 days
Last active Tue, Jan, 27 2015 09:50:15
- 0 Followers
- 96 Total Posts
- 0 Thanks
Aug 11, 2008I second that. Wait, you are talking to me? ;)Posted in: General AddOns
The current plan is to turn LibStickyFrames into optional support - but I do not know really, since the lib is written by Sorata too which means there is currently neither maintainment nor development.
Is there anyone out there liking that feature?
I guess I will have a look how much overhead code it would produce to optionalize it.
The fade option was gonna be the next feature I wanted to implement.
It has not happened yet because I wanted to do one thing "right" at a time, one step etc.
But I kinda **** up with the Durations module, there?s a bug in it which I do not find grml.
Considering UnitAuras change with WotLK anyway, I will put Durations on a hold and get to fade out the next time I do a coding session.
Speaking of WotLK, Poppins does not work with it because of a change in the Secure Frames API.
Currently I have no idea how hard it will be to adapt the code.
If someone around is into the changes and wants to have a look at the beta, feel free to do so - it would save me many hours of research since I am pretty noobish on the SecureStateHeader anyway.
Just wanting to mention this really early because I am writing my master thesis fearing doing this alone could kill my time planning and we want a smooth transition do we not :D
Jul 30, 2008If it is new i suppose it has to do with changes in LibKeybound like keybindings now are only applied after clicking ok.Posted in: General AddOns
Said Ok, abort window works slightly different now if I recall correctly.
Might have a look at the Libkeybound thread if you are curious, I will however double check if the implementation in Poppins needs to be updated on the next possible occasion.
Jul 24, 2008If everyone is talking legal, would there not have to be sueing involved before anyone would *have* to take an addon down?Posted in: General Chat
I would suppose wowi, curseforge etc. have those checkmarks for agreeing to only upload own data for exactly that purpose - not being the one that can be attacked for other peoples violences.
Edit: Oh well, I guess that depends on national law so the question is more academic i guess.
Jul 24, 2008The comments of Rabbit and Moonwitch lead to the other side of the medaillon not even mentioned in the article.Posted in: General Chat
In english I suppose it is called "patent abuse".
Patent something really obvious that every sane being would do this exact same way and profit.
Of course here is no money involved, but protecting copyrights is not a good thing per se.
I know many might not agree with this, but I find it questionable if the limited possibilities within the wow api offer enough freedom to actually claim intellectual property often. You are not the only beautiful snowflake or sth ;)
I am pretty aware I am not that good at coding, but at cases like that I personally can not help seeing it as copyrighting 3+4=7 in a sense.
But that may be a personal vision problem though being discussable.
Jul 21, 2008I am thinking how this would be achieved best.Posted in: General AddOns
There actually is a nice table returning function already present in Poppins, I wonder if it would be in the category of too much Poppins specific code or unuseful in some other way.
will return all currently used Frames and Popbuttons (used in the sense that there is caching involved and there may be unused buttons).
The button of the frame is stored in .button.
So in the end all buttons are accessible via for example
for frame in Poppins.Frame:Iterate() do frame.button:DoSomething() end for button in Poppins.PopButton:Iterate() do button:DoSomething() end
I wonder if this would already "do it" for you?
Jul 20, 2008Basically all of them work like this atm. Why not study SBF and other addon for inspiration? That is what I do when I wonder about how I implement something the best way.Posted in: Lua Code Discussion
The thing worth considering for you is if you want to run through UnitBuff on every aura change or if you want to create a time threshold, so if 5 auras on a unit change in 5 ms or sth. the function is not called 5 times.
Mostly this would be possible in pvp though - another event worth mentioning is if a player dies so you can just nil all his buffs.
Jul 19, 2008Hm, if I may ask stupidly:Posted in: General AddOns
What exactly would you need again?
The original author has not been around for a while and I am mainly doing some bug fixing and polishing - read: I am often a bit confused and overwhelmed when it comes to the whole frame state stuff.
Basically a one dimensional table with all the buttons and popbuttons names as a list, or the objects themselves or...?
Jul 3, 2008krage: fix is up on the svn, zip will take 10 minutes or soPosted in: General AddOns
i did not have much time testing though, so feel free to report back if it works better for you now.
I think there is an invisible button haunting the around mode, do not ask me why.
Possibly the introduction of frame strata settings made it angry...
You might test what happens if you raise the frame strata of the button higher than the strata of the popbutton.
Does this change anything?
Otherwise I will try to reproduce this when I am in game next time and go hunting this bug.
Jul 3, 2008You are missing...the function ;)Posted in: General AddOns
Actually no one has asked for this yet, considering most people do not use many buttons I assume.
So currently you just delete the buttons and the group (if I wonder what are the names of the buttons I want to delete I just unlock the buttons to see their number).
It would of course be possible to implement, but I am not really convinced of it being high priority.
So, I will put this on my to-do-in-some-time list, if you can tell me how/why it could be a deal breaker for you, I am convinceable to move it up.
Jun 25, 2008ButtonFacade:Posted in: General AddOns
It is very annoying to debug since I cannot force it, though no eat on this.
Plus the BF things are mostly Soratas code I am sometimes having trouble getting it (or the other way round I mostly know where in my code I do terrible terrible things that are likely to break).
I will look at the Strata level - it is strange since I have tested it with Pitbull and the chat frame working well.
Isup I have forgotten a call somewhere, maybe it just works fine immediately after changing it in the options. Do you know which Strata Grid uses? Maybe if both are high this could result in this inconsistence too.
The library is there because either I failed to use the API correctly or there is a bug in the following circumstance:
Unlike SBF for example I need durations not only timeleft (SBF just sets duration = timeleft if there is trouble). So I, most naturally attempted to get them via UnitBuff. The problem there is: If you *have* Buffs while logging in, UnitBuff seems to deliver the name of the Buff, but nils on duration. I first used a code to cache the durations when UnitBuff is working in the db, but afterall it became more complicated then just use simple table calls. Because of that I borrowed the table style organization of RBM to get the duration nevertheless. If I could work that out, the lib would be gone again isup (Although I would have to create a blacklist for interruption on CLE and Spell Succeeded on runtime again - but that is not a big deal. The tables are in a lib just because there is some stuff on the branches that could use this too if it is used properly which I know the durations code does not yet (will be cached instead of recalled if I do not find a way to get UnitBuff working). I assumed the lib being just helper functions would not produce much overhead.
The whole thing is not working quite well yet, the other main problem is that I atm create another cd layer which is not the way I wanted it, but since TotemTimers RawHooks UpdateCooldown I fear trouble if I do the same in Durations.
Now that you mention it, "Iteration" is written like that in german too, was just copying the stuff ;)
- To post a comment, please login or register a new account.